[jira] [Created] (ARTEMIS-1370) Artemis consumer command, does not accept a ClientID arg

Pat Fox created ARTEMIS-1370:
--------------------------------

             Summary: Artemis consumer command, does not accept a ClientID arg 
                 Key: ARTEMIS-1370
                 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/ARTEMIS-1370
             Project: ActiveMQ Artemis
          Issue Type: Improvement
          Components: Broker
    Affects Versions: 2.3.0
            Reporter: Pat Fox
            Priority: Minor


using 
{code}
./artemis consumer --destination topic://myexample --durable
{code}

it gives me

{code}
javax.jms.IllegalStateException: Cannot create durable subscription - client ID has not been set
	at org.apache.activemq.artemis.jms.client.ActiveMQSession.createConsumer(ActiveMQSession.java:746)
	at org.apache.activemq.artemis.jms.client.ActiveMQSession.createDurableSubscriber(ActiveMQSession.java:484)
	at org.apache.activemq.artemis.jms.client.ActiveMQSession.createDurableSubscriber(ActiveMQSession.java:458)
	at org.apache.activemq.artemis.cli.commands.messages.ConsumerThread.consume(ConsumerThread.java:140)
	at org.apache.activemq.artemis.cli.commands.messages.ConsumerThread.run(ConsumerThread.java:64)
{code}

There currently seems no command line option available to set a client id when running artemis consumer.
